The Structural Advantage: Built Like a Tank
- 360° steel enclosure resists physical deformation
- Standardized pressure release valves prevent catastrophic failures
- Optimized internal spacing for thermal management
Think of cylindrical batteries as the "safety-first architects" of the battery world. Their circular cross-section distributes mechanical stress evenly – a game-changer in electric vehicles where vibration resistance matters.

FAQ: Your Safety Questions Answered
- Q: How do cylindrical cells prevent explosions?A: Their pressure vents activate at precise thresholds, safely releasing gases before critical pressure builds.
